Congratulations to Ruben D. S., a student at Marshall McLuhan Catholic Secondary School, who was named BGC (formerly Boys & Girls Club) Canada’s National Youth of the Year, selected from among four incredible finalists across the country. This national recognition celebrates outstanding young leaders who exemplify the values of service, leadership, and resilience. As the winner, Ruben receives a $10,000 scholarship toward post-secondary education, a new laptop, and additional supports to help him continue his journey. The award ceremony was attended by Mayor Olivia Chow and the Minister of Children and Community, Hon. Michael Parsa, highlighting the significance of this achievement.
As Angelo Castillo, Community Director at BGC Weston Mount Dennis & Lawrence Heights Club, said:
"Ruben has been involved with BGC St. Alban’s Club for 10 years—as a member, volunteer, and staff—and I’ve had the privilege of mentoring him since he first joined our summer camp programs. It has been truly inspiring to watch him grow into the confident, compassionate leader he is today.
Ruben speaks with pride about his school community and the opportunities he has had to lead and support others at Marshall McLuhan Catholic Secondary School and the Toronto Catholic District School Board (TCDSB) as a whole, which is why I wanted to personally share this wonderful achievement with you."
